Android 4.0引入了一项很重要的技术就是 WiFiDirect (WiFi直连) ,它可以让WiFi设备无需热点即可实现两个WiFi设备的P2P数据交换。使用最新的Android 4.0 SDK,最低API Level 14才支持此项技术,在SDK的例子中我们可以看到很多界面用到了Android 3.0时代的Fragment容器。

首先我们需要实现android.net.wifi.p2p.WifiP2pManager.ChannelListener 接口来获取支持WiFi直连的Android设备。

public class WiFiDirectActivity extends Activityimplements ChannelListener, DeviceActionListener {

public static final String TAG = "wifidirectdemo";
private WifiP2pManager manager;
private boolean isWifiP2pEnabled = false;
private boolean retryChannel = false;

private final IntentFilter intentFilter = new IntentFilter();
private Channel channel;
private BroadcastReceiver receiver = null;

public void setIsWifiP2pEnabled(boolean isWifiP2pEnabled) { //设置一个标记是否启用WiFi直连
this.isWifiP2pEnabled = isWifiP2pEnabled;
}

@Override
public void onCreate(Bundle savedInstanceState) {
super.onCreate(savedInstanceState);
setContentView(R.layout.main);

//注册所需要处理的action,比如WiFi连接、状态改变等。

intentFilter.addAction(WifiP2pManager.WIFI_P2P_STATE_CHANGED_ACTION);
intentFilter.addAction(WifiP2pManager.WIFI_P2P_PEERS_CHANGED_ACTION);
intentFilter.addAction(WifiP2pManager.WIFI_P2P_CONNECTION_CHANGED_ACTION);
intentFilter.addAction(WifiP2pManager.WIFI_P2P_THIS_DEVICE_CHANGED_ACTION);

manager = (WifiP2pManager) getSystemService(Context.WIFI_P2P_SERVICE);
channel = manager.initialize(this, getMainLooper(), null); //实例化WifiP2pManager对象
}

@Override
public void onResume() {
super.onResume();
receiver = new WiFiDirectBroadcastReceiver(manager, channel, this);
registerReceiver(receiver, intentFilter);
}

@Override
public void onPause() {
super.onPause();
unregisterReceiver(receiver);
}

public void resetData() {
DeviceListFragment fragmentList = (DeviceListFragment) getFragmentManager()
.findFragmentById(R.id.frag_list);
DeviceDetailFragment fragmentDetails = (DeviceDetailFragment) getFragmentManager()
.findFragmentById(R.id.frag_detail);
if (fragmentList != null) {
fragmentList.clearPeers();
}
if (fragmentDetails != null) {
fragmentDetails.resetViews();
}
}

@Override
public boolean onCreateOptionsMenu(Menu menu) {
MenuInflater inflater = getMenuInflater();
inflater.inflate(R.menu.action_items, menu);
return true;
}

@Override
public boolean onOptionsItemSelected(MenuItem item) {
switch (item.getItemId()) {
case R.id.atn_direct_enable:
if (manager != null && channel != null) {

startActivity(new Intent(Settings.ACTION_WIRELESS_SETTINGS));
} else {
Log.e(TAG, "channel or manager is null");
}
return true;

case R.id.atn_direct_discover:
if (!isWifiP2pEnabled) {
Toast.makeText(WiFiDirectActivity.this, R.string.p2p_off_warning,
Toast.LENGTH_SHORT).show();
return true;
}
final DeviceListFragment fragment = (DeviceListFragment) getFragmentManager()
.findFragmentById(R.id.frag_list);
fragment.onInitiateDiscovery();
manager.discoverPeers(channel, new WifiP2pManager.ActionListener() {

@Override
public void onSuccess() {
Toast.makeText(WiFiDirectActivity.this, "Discovery Initiated",
Toast.LENGTH_SHORT).show();
}

@Override
public void onFailure(int reasonCode) {
Toast.makeText(WiFiDirectActivity.this, "Discovery Failed : " + reasonCode,
Toast.LENGTH_SHORT).show();
}
});
return true;
default:
return super.onOptionsItemSelected(item);
}
}

@Override
public void showDetails(WifiP2pDevice device) {
DeviceDetailFragment fragment = (DeviceDetailFragment) getFragmentManager()
.findFragmentById(R.id.frag_detail);
fragment.showDetails(device);

}

@Override
public void connect(WifiP2pConfig config) {
manager.connect(channel, config, new ActionListener() {

@Override
public void onSuccess() {
// WiFiDirectBroadcastReceiver will notify us. Ignore for now.
}

@Override
public void onFailure(int reason) {
Toast.makeText(WiFiDirectActivity.this, "Connect failed. Retry.",
Toast.LENGTH_SHORT).show();
}
});
}

@Override
public void disconnect() {
final DeviceDetailFragment fragment = (DeviceDetailFragment) getFragmentManager()
.findFragmentById(R.id.frag_detail);
fragment.resetViews();
manager.removeGroup(channel, new ActionListener() {

@Override
public void onFailure(int reasonCode) {
Log.d(TAG, "Disconnect failed. Reason :" + reasonCode);

}

@Override
public void onSuccess() {
fragment.getView().setVisibility(View.GONE);
}

});
}

@Override
public void onChannelDisconnected() {
// we will try once more
if (manager != null && !retryChannel) {
Toast.makeText(this, "Channel lost. Trying again", Toast.LENGTH_LONG).show();
resetData();
retryChannel = true;
manager.initialize(this, getMainLooper(), this);
} else {
Toast.makeText(this,
"Severe! Channel is probably lost premanently. Try Disable/Re-Enable P2P.",
Toast.LENGTH_LONG).show();
}
}

@Override
public void cancelDisconnect() {

if (manager != null) {
final DeviceListFragment fragment = (DeviceListFragment) getFragmentManager()
.findFragmentById(R.id.frag_list);
if (fragment.getDevice() == null
|| fragment.getDevice().status == WifiP2pDevice.CONNECTED) {
disconnect();
} else if (fragment.getDevice().status == WifiP2pDevice.AVAILABLE
|| fragment.getDevice().status == WifiP2pDevice.INVITED) {

manager.cancelConnect(channel, new ActionListener() {

@Override
public void onSuccess() {
Toast.makeText(WiFiDirectActivity.this, "Aborting connection",
Toast.LENGTH_SHORT).show();
}

@Override
public void onFailure(int reasonCode) {
Toast.makeText(WiFiDirectActivity.this,
"Connect abort request failed. Reason Code: " + reasonCode,
Toast.LENGTH_SHORT).show();
}
});
}
}

}
}
